Art Museum

Known to be the largest museums between West Coast and Chicago, Denver art museum boasts of 68, 000 plus collections of work from all over the world. However, the museum is more known for collection of American Indian Art. The museum also offers hands-on activities for all age group of people, with charges included in the admission fees. Visitors are seen indulging in activities like, Gallery Games, Just for Fun Center, Kid’s Corner, Sculpting and Art Making.

Rocky Mountain National Park

For the adventure lovers, Denver has various outdoor activities like hiking, rock climbing, fishing and water rafting. There is a National Park which features over 350 miles of trails running through wildflowers, majestic mountains and abundant wildlife. One can enjoy a leisurely hike around a mountain lake or go for backpacking mountain climbing, with both the activities offering stimulation for the body and soul.

Sampling Craft Brews

Some of the most famous breweries in the world are located in Denver. A sightseeing package in Denver includes a 30 minute visit to the legendary Coors Brewery, enlightening the visitors about activities like brewing, malting and packaging. Coors Brewery is one of the largest single-site breweries in the entire world. Tourists are allowed to brew their own beer and sample it too.

Denver Botanic Gardens

For the nature lovers, there is Denver’s famous botanical garden, which is spread over 23 acres of land and houses theme gardens, sunken amphitheater and a conservatory. The garden is divided into three segments, namely, Denver Botanic Gardens near Chatfield State Park, formal garden in east-central Denver and Mt. Goliath on the way to Mount Evans. Shopper’s Paradise

Denver’s Cherry Creek North Shopping District is a dream come true for every avid shopper. Consisting of 16 blocks of shopping and dining areas, Cherry Creek is located just 5 minutes from downtown Denver, surrounded by Steele, University and First and Third Avenue Streets. The shopping area has more than 160 shops having high-end brands like Burberry, Louis Vuitton and Ralph Lauren selling their wares. Shoppers can also try out bakery products and coffee after a long and tiring day.
